pho·ney
adjective/ˈfəʊni/
/ˈfəʊni/
(also phony)
(comparative phonier, superlative phoniest)
(informal, disapproving)- not real or true; false, and trying to trick people
synonym fake假的;冒充的;欺骗的 - She spoke with a phoney Russian accent.
她用一种伪装的俄国腔调说话。
